Hi all - I'm in the process of building my 6016 kit and am trying to replicate the Halsey method of building the 6 gear transmission as per this scan: http://www.rc10talk.com/viewtopic.php?f=7&t=3748&hilit=halsey+six+gear .
I have a couple of clarificatory questions regarding a couple of the steps which I could really do with answering before progressing this. They are as follows:
1. What exactly is being done in Step 1? The picture isn't clear enough and I'm not sure what they mean by "burrs" on the metal gears that should be removed. I'm looking at my metal gears and they all seem to be smooth and fine right out of the packet. What am I missing here?
2. What exactly is being done in Step 18? I'm not sure I follow the description correctly - doesn't seem to make sense to me when they say "grind the radius left from the round cutter to a 90 degree angle". Obviously Step 17 says that you need to grind down the little step on each transmission side which distinguishes where the metal gears (as opposed to the idler gears) are located. Is Step 18 saying that you need to grind the side of each transmission where the metal gears are down to the same level as that where the idlergears are located? And what is at a "90 degree angle"?
Any clarification/help much appreciated from those 6-Gear experts out there. Thanks!

For step one, I don't think you're decreasing the root diameter, as much as removing the steel burrs on the teeth from when the gears were machined. AE never did a good job at deburring the gears and if that's not done, they tend to bind a little (and wear out the idler gears faster). I always preferred to use a small triangular file to do this instead of a dremel; it's too easy to remove too much material very quickly.

Yes. On the steel outdrives, the burrs tend to look like bits of "flashing" along the sides of the teeth.CNA75 wrote:When you refer to "burrs" here do you mean any odd protrusions on the gears which were not machined off during the machining process?
In steps 17 & 18, you're removing some material from the inside of the case so the outer side of the outdrive gear doesn't rub against the inside of the case.
